摘要
真菌SIPI-8917菌株的代谢产物具有抑制胆固醇生物合成酶活性,对其代谢产物进一步研究,应用丙酮浸泡、溶媒萃取、硅胶柱分离和LH20凝胶层析等方法,从其菌丝体中分离出另一种化合物,命名为SIPI-8917-Ⅴ。根据质谱(EI-MS、FAB和HRMS)数据,确定其分子式为:C28H44O1(分子量:396.3370),综合紫外光谱、红外光谱、1H-NMR、13C-NMR及HMBC和HMQC等图谱数据的解析,确定其结构为甾醇类化合物,旋光活性研究表明:与文献报道的麦角甾醇(ergosterol)结构一致,化学命名为:麦角-5,7,22E-三烯-3β-醇(ergosta-5,7,22E-trien-3β-ol)。
The metabolites of a positive strain named SIPI 8917 exhibited inhibitory activities on cholesterol biosynthetic enzyme. In the following studies, physiologically active compound SIPI 8917 Ⅴ was isolated from the mycelia of fungi SIPI 8917 by acetone soaking, solvent extraction, silica gel column, LH20 column chromatography etc .. Based on EI MS, FAB and HRMS, its formula was determined to be C 28 H 44 O (MW: 396.3370). By the analyses of UV, IR, 1H NMR, 13 C NMR, HMQC and HMBC etc . spectra data, the structure of SIPI 8917 Ⅴ was elucidated and was identical with that of ergosterol, and its chemical name is ergosta 5,7,22E trien 3β ol.
